i should add: the model is varnished in a even 3 way mix of lahmian medium, stormshield and water. I find this blend gives an ever so slight satin finish (not too gloss and not too matt). It helps bring out the vibrancy and also protects the model which is very necessary for metal models especially that are prone to chipping or flaking paint without protection

The red->yellow carapace is a fair bit of work, but worth it IMO, took me about 10 hours over 2-3 sessions. The complete model was about 15-20 hours

Undercoat is black with a white zenithal done with airbrush

Airbrush work started with evil sunz scarlet, then raised sections with trollslayer orange and then yriel yellow. Might have done some intermediary steps mixing from one to the next to get more even blends. I went overboard with the yellow so went back and forth a bit to bring back the reds.

Brush details I did VERY careful but comprehensive edge highlights with grey seer (anything close to white will do) then repainted over them with yriel yellow reason for this is to get strong opacity with yellow is really hard without doing a million layers, so laying down the light grey first is a bit of cheat to get results with the yellow.

then repainted over yellow highlights with a thin glaze consistency of trollslayer orange to bring down the highlights everywhere except the most raised/edge final bits you want to keep at max yellow

Green was base coated caliban green, layered highlight, warpstone glow, edge highlight moot green, then carefully flood the sides and recesses with biel-tan green shade If you need a bit more 'pop' after than, a small selective edge highlight of gauss blaster green used sparingly

I build them using cork sheet that I layered. Then just based in dark brown and dry brushed with lighter browns. Glued on some grass. The water is Kantor blue with some swirly highlights and then a heap of gloss varnish on top. I used GW Ardcoat

It’s basic chemistry... the media is soda lime which is usually made with sodium hydroxide and calcium hydroxide and is used for many co2 absorbing applications including rebreathers in scuba diving. Having the scrubber connected to my skimmer increased my ph average by 0.2-0.3ph from my baseline.

I have run kalk for such a long time I don’t know the baseline without it. But I struggled wigg Th very low ph prior to starting kalk which increased it a lot. But add in the scrubber has further increased it and also stabilised to a smaller swing during the day.

My ph swing currently is about 8.0-8.2 ish during the day.
